If Inglewood was riding high fresh off their 3-0 takedown of Animo Leadership on Tuesday, their most recent game may have dampened their spirits a bit. The Sentinels fell just short of the New West Charter Eagles by a score of 3-2 on Thursday. While the Sentinels didn't get the win, they did start the game off strong, beating the Eagles 25-16 in the first set.
Inglewood actually scored more points across those five sets (105-102), but sadly they still had to settle for second.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 16-25, 25-16, 25-22, 17-25, 19-17.
Janae Canty paced Inglewood's offense, picking up 12 kills. Canty got some help from Julia Ibe and her 15 assists. Canty was also solid from the service line: she led the team with eight aces.
Inglewood's loss dropped their record down to 2-2. As for New West Charter, the win got them back to even at 1-1.
After both having extra time off, Inglewood and Hawkins will shake off the cobwebs and hit the court against one another at 4:30 p.m. on Wednesday. As for New West Charter, they will look to take advantage of their home court for the first time this season as they take on Community Charter at 3:00 p.m. on Friday.
